Here is an introduction to the production method of apple cider vinegar in English:
1. Material preparation: Select fresh apples, peel and core them into small pieces.
2. Fermentation: Put the apple pieces into a fermentation tank, add a suitable amount of pure water, and then add vinegar bacteria for fermentation. During the fermentation process, it is necessary to maintain proper temperature and humidity to ensure the activity of the vinegar bacteria.
3. Filtration: After fermentation, filter out the residue and impurities of the apple cider vinegar.
4. Blending: Add a suitable amount of sugar, honey or other seasonings according to taste to adjust the taste and flavor.
5. Sterilization: Sterilize the blended apple cider vinegar with high-temperature sterilization to ensure the safety and hygiene of the product.
6. Packaging: Fill the sterilized apple cider vinegar into clean bottles, seal and store.
